Sandstone Trail at Kisatchie NF, Kisatchie district (aka Red Dirt). Excellent 26 mi main loop with a shorter 6 mi or so inner loop. Sandy, hilly and rocky with several creek crossings. Most crossings are bridged but a few are natural and interesting. A great campground at the bayou with the closest thing to rapids in our state.
